Distance from Shagari to Onitsha (Nigeria)

The distance between Shagari, Sokoto and Onitsha, Anambra is 743 kilometers (462 miles).

Shagari, Sokoto, Nigeria

Onitsha, Anambra, Nigeria

From Shagari to Onitsha, the straight-line distance is 743 kilometers, heading south. Shagari is situated at an altitude of 279 meters above sea level, while Onitsha is at 57 meters.

Travel time

Mode Estimated time
Bicycle 2-3 days
Motorcycle 1 day
Car 16-18 hours
Helicopter 3-4 hours
Airplane 1-2 hours
Speed Time
30 km/h
60 km/h
90 km/h
120 km/h
Shagari, Nigeria

Local time:

Time Zone: Africa/Lagos

Coordinates: 12.6273° N 4.993° E

Elevation: 279 m (915 ft)


Nearby airports:
  • Sokoto (SKO)
  • Maradi Airport (MFQ)
  • Tahoua Airport (THZ)
  • Kandi Airport (KDC)
  • Diori Hamani International Airport (NIM)
Onitsha, Nigeria

Local time:

Time Zone: Africa/Lagos

Coordinates: 6.1498° N 6.7857° E

Elevation: 57 m (187 ft)


Nearby airports:
  • Asaba International Airport (ABB)
  • Sam Mbakwe International Airport (QOW)
  • Akanu Ibiam International Airport (ENU)
  • Warri Airport (QRW)
  • Port Harcourt International Airport (PHC)

Other distances from Shagari

Distance between cities Kilometers
From Shagari to Lagos 705 km
From Shagari to Abuja 480 km
From Shagari to Kano 390 km
From Shagari to Port Harcourt 896 km
From Shagari to Kaduna 354 km

Other distances from Onitsha

Distances between cities Kilometers
From Onitsha to Lagos 377 km
From Onitsha to Abuja 331 km
From Onitsha to Kano 674 km
From Onitsha to Port Harcourt 154 km
From Onitsha to Kaduna 489 km

Cities within similar distances

The following list contains the cities of Nigeria that are at equal or similar distances as between Shagari and Onitsha.

From To Distance (kilometers)
Paris, France Bilbao, Spain 743 km
Reynosa, Mexico Ciudad Nezahualcoyotl, Mexico 743 km
Reynosa, Mexico Fort Worth, United States 742 km
Reynosa, Mexico Miguel Hidalgo, Mexico 742 km
Mexico City, Mexico Reynosa, Mexico 742 km
Córdoba, Argentina Salta, Argentina 744 km
San Antonio, United States Chihuahua, Mexico 745 km
Reynosa, Mexico Iztacalco, Mexico 745 km
Reynosa, Mexico Cuauhtémoc, Mexico 740 km
Torreón, Mexico Ciudad Juárez, Mexico 746 km
Reynosa, Mexico Venustiano Carranza, Mexico 740 km
Austin, United States New Orleans, United States 740 km
Reynosa, Mexico Arlington, United States 746 km
Barranquilla, Colombia Valencia, Venezuela 747 km
Nashville, United States Cleveland, United States 738 km
Kyiv, Ukraine Bucharest, Romania 748 km
Quito, Ecuador Chiclayo, Peru 738 km
Reynosa, Mexico Naucalpan de Juárez, Mexico 738 km
Oklahoma City, United States Colorado Springs, United States 748 km
Málaga, Spain Bilbao, Spain 738 km

Measure more distances between cities